From 58e8d5c397ed5de017f3d84ae89d6448ca1468d2 Mon Sep 17 00:00:00 2001 From: Akim Demaille Date: Tue, 12 Sep 2000 13:02:29 +0000 Subject: [PATCH] * acgeneral.m4 (_AC_TRY_CPP): New macro. It runs the preprocessor and checks whether it produces errors or warnings. Don't put grep output into a variable, use another grep instead. (AC_TRY_CPP): Use _AC_TRY_CPP. Copy conftest.err to config.log if the case of an error. * aclang.m4 (AC_LANG(C), AC_LANG(C++), AC_LANG(Fortran 77)): define AC_LANG_ABBREV to the short language name. (_AC_PROG_CPP_WORKS): New macro. It checks whether the current preprocessor can be used to check for existance of headers. Most code taken from ... (AC_PROG_CPP): ... here. Use _AC_PROG_CPP_WORKS. Use shell "for" to find working CPP. Use AC_LANG_PUSH(C) and AC_LANG_POP - it's a macro for C only.
